About The Position

Responsible for the successful management and execution of all non-baseball events at T-Mobile Park, ensuring safe, efficient, and exceptional experiences for clients, guests and team members. Additionally, this position works closely with the Ballpark Operations team to support the successful management of game day events, as needed.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in sport management, business administration or related field required. Equivalent, relevant work experience may be considered in lieu of formal education, if approved by management.
  • A minimum of five (5) years of relevant experience in event management or a related field required. A minimum of three (3) years in a management capacity leading large-scale, complex events with direct reports is preferred.
  • Strong proficiency with Microsoft Office required. Able to learn new software programs and systems.

Responsibilities

  • Manage, train, evaluate, and foster growth of Team Members, encouraging personal and professional development.
  • Lead and Execute non-baseball events in coordination with operations, support staff and any relevant departments and stakeholders.
  • Work closely with Coordinator, Ballpark Operations and Manager, Conversion to deploy the Ballpark Event Operations Crew efficiently, and identify opportunities to streamline processes and improve operational effectiveness.
  • Partner with Event Sales department to provide guidance on operational planning and costs for self-promoted and facility rental events
  • Evaluate, improve and enhance intradepartmental communications, including event sheets, event meetings and other information sharing tools.
  • Manage event execution from confirmation to completion, and serve as central point of communication for both the client and all internal departments. This includes advancing all details, coordinating vendors, managing deliveries, and enforcing timelines.
  • Serve as a client liaison through event planning process; provide excellent customer service, quick thinking and problem solving.
  • Meet with ballpark clients to assist in determining event needs and identify any concerns, and offer creative solutions. This includes conducting facility site visits.
  • Prepare comprehensive written documentation for each event including floor plans and code compliance.
  • Coordinate with the Event Sales department to control and reduce event costs and operate within approved budgets.
  • Coordinate with department heads and scheduling coordinators to generate timely schedules for staff
  • Communicate all pertinent event details and department requests in a timely and efficient manner.
  • Serve as Ballpark representative at events; enforces T-Mobile Park practices and procedures throughout each event.
  • Lead with a positive attitude and demonstrate commitment to all Team Members. Manage and teach the operation while holding all Team Members accountable for delivering the Mariners Way to guests and to each other.
  • Follow all organizational labor guidelines and human resources policies and regulations and monitor for compliance.
  • Support and champion all programs and initiatives of the Mariners Way and maintain a culture where Team Members strive to create Exceptional Experiences for all guests.
  • Act as Front Office liaison with other departments to maintain channels of communication and distribution of information for all aspects of non-baseball events.
  • Troubleshoot quickly and efficiently to solve Team Member and guest issues.
